Liquid damage is a race against time. The moment water, coffee, juice, or any liquid enters an electronic device, corrosion begins. Minerals and salts in tap water and other liquids attack copper traces, tin solder, and component legs on the circuit board. The faster you act — and the more correctly you act — the better your chances of recovery. If your device has been exposed to liquid, turn it off immediately, remove the battery if accessible, and do not try to charge it or turn it on. Our liquid damage repair process goes beyond the "put it in rice" myth that delays proper treatment by days. We disassemble the device completely, inspect the board under magnification, perform an ultrasonic cleaning cycle with specialist solution to dissolve and flush corrosion, and then carefully assess which components have sustained permanent damage. In many cases — particularly when devices are brought in promptly — we achieve full functional recovery. Even devices that have been sitting in a drawer for weeks can sometimes be revived once the corrosion is properly addressed.

Toilet, sink, pool, ocean — any submersion requires immediate attention. Even IP-rated devices can fail when seals are aged or pressure exceeds rating.
Sugary, acidic drinks are more damaging than plain water due to their chemical composition. They leave residue that continues corroding after the liquid dries.
Prolonged rain exposure or riding in a bag while wet can introduce moisture through ports, buttons, and speaker meshes even without full submersion.
A spilled drink on a keyboard travels directly to the motherboard. This is one of the most time-critical liquid damage scenarios — shut the laptop immediately.
Speaker mesh saturated with liquid produces muffled sound. Sometimes this resolves as it dries, but liquid in the speaker housing can cause permanent damage if untreated.
A device that went through the wash, fell in a bath, or was soaked in rain and now won't respond. Turn off completely and do not attempt to charge.
Liquid exposure can cause rapid battery degradation and swelling. A swollen battery after liquid damage needs immediate removal and replacement.
Visible green or white residue around the charging port, SIM slot, or board connectors indicates active corrosion that needs to be cleaned before it spreads.

Bring your device in immediately — or call us to discuss the situation. The first 24 hours are critical. We prioritise liquid damage cases and aim to begin assessment the same day.
We fully disassemble the device and inspect the board under magnification, checking liquid indicator strips, corrosion presence, and any shorted components.
The logic board is placed in our ultrasonic cleaner with specialist PCB cleaning solution. This removes mineral deposits and corrosion that cotton swabs and isopropyl alone can't reach.
After cleaning and drying, we power on the board in a controlled environment and test all subsystems. Any remaining faults are identified for targeted repair or component replacement.
Once satisfied the board is clean and functional, we reassemble with fresh seals where applicable, test all hardware functions thoroughly, and return the device with a repair report.
